## Arthritis Care in the Bangor, Maine Area: A Deep Dive for Patients
Finding the right healthcare for arthritis can be a complex undertaking. This review focuses on hospitals and healthcare resources near the 04428 ZIP code (Bangor, Maine) to provide patients with a fact-rich assessment of their options. We’ll delve into hospital ratings, specialty centers, emergency room wait times, and the availability of telehealth services, all crucial factors in making informed decisions about arthritis care.
**Flagship Hospitals and CMS Star Ratings:**
The primary hospital serving the Bangor area is Northern Light Eastern Maine Medical Center (EMMC), located within the 04428 ZIP code. EMMC is a large regional referral center and a major player in healthcare for the region. As of late 2023, EMMC holds a 3-star rating from the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S). This rating reflects a composite score based on various quality measures, including patient safety, effectiveness of care, and patient experience. While a 3-star rating is considered average, it's essential to understand the specific metrics contributing to this score. Patients should investigate areas where the hospital excels and where it may need improvement.
EMMC's Joint Replacement Center is a key component of its orthopedic services. This center offers comprehensive care for arthritis, including diagnosis, medical management, physical therapy, and surgical interventions like joint replacements. The center's success rates, infection rates, and patient satisfaction scores are vital data points for prospective patients. Researching these specifics is crucial.

**Telehealth and Remote Patient Monitoring:**
Telehealth services have become increasingly important, particularly for chronic conditions like arthritis. Northern Light Health offers telehealth options, including virtual consultations with rheumatologists and other healthcare providers. Telehealth can be a convenient way to manage arthritis, especially for follow-up appointments, medication adjustments, and patient education.
The availability of remote patient monitoring (RPM) programs is another factor to consider. RPM allows patients to track their symptoms, vital signs, and medication adherence at home, which can be shared with their healthcare providers. This technology can help patients and physicians stay connected, monitor disease progression, and adjust treatment plans as needed.
**Physical Therapy and Rehabilitation Services:**
Physical therapy plays a crucial role in managing arthritis symptoms and improving quality of life. EMMC and other healthcare providers in the area offer physical therapy and rehabilitation services. These services can help patients strengthen muscles, improve joint mobility, and reduce pain.
The availability of specialized physical therapy programs for different types of arthritis is another factor to consider. Some programs may focus on aquatic therapy, which can be particularly beneficial for patients with joint pain. Others may offer occupational therapy to help patients adapt their daily activities to minimize pain and improve function.
